CVE-2022-50036

CVE-2022-50036 affects the Linux kernel component drm/sun4i: dsi. The underflow occurred when computing packet sizes due to subtracting packet overhead with unsigned arithmetic; with a short sync pulse the subtraction could wrap to a large unsigned value.
